Indolic uremic solutes increase tissue factor production in endothelial cells by the aryl hydrocarbon receptor pathway

In chronic kidney disease (CKD), uremic solutes accumulate in blood and tissues. These compounds probably contribute to the marked increase in cardiovascular risk during the progression of CKD.
